Why this petition matters
This petition is to express our strong opposition to #21-09 and any use of 3 Lake Avenue Extension LLC, 3 Lake Ave. Ext., (G15005), CA-80 Zone, Use Variance Sec. 5.B.2.a as “shelter for homeless with conditions.”
While the application for a rezone has been withdrawn by the applicant, the facility is still being operated as a shelter as our Mayor Joseph Cavo stated during the public forum, for the Mentally ill, drug addicted and homeless persons being brought into our community. Our Police chief also agreed and confirmed three sexual assaults during the first 120 days of 2021. We are petitioning that this activity and use of the facility cease until further review by the city, an independent service to assess the impact and danger to the children in the surrounding communities.
Danbury must put the safety of its children as the number 1 priority and do everything to ensure their safety, in the local schools and surrounding communities within walking distance of the facility.
The current use and future proposed rezoning is detrimental to the area. The volume of police engagement with the address and surrounding areas has increased substantially since the temporary use of this facility as a shelter is alarming, and the proximity to multiple local elementary schools is of grave concern. Again, the safety of our children is and will continue to be our community’s number one priority. Danbury cannot put the children and the community at risk.
Danbury has the appropriate facilities and organizations to support our local homeless. This mega shelter is unnecessary and poses a substantial risk to the safety of our community.
We urge you to disapprove the proposed rezoning and use of this facility as a shelter and low income dwelling.
Thank you for your continued service and support of our communities.
